About This Book
Belle the Dog believes she can see everything in her neighborhood—until Henry the Heron shows her the world from way up high! How can a dog see like a bird? Together, they discover that seeing through someone else’s eyes can turn an ordinary day into an amazing adventure.

Quick Assessment
This charming early reader story follows Belle, a dog who meets Henry, a heron, and learns to appreciate different perspectives in her neighborhood. Suitable for children aged 5 to 8, it encourages empathy, friendship, and community awareness without any challenging content. The simple narrative and relatable themes support early literacy and social development.
Why we rated Adventures of Belle - Belle Meets Henry 7C
Adventures of Belle - Belle Meets Henry is written at a Level 2 reading level across 44 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 3.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Adventures of Belle - Belle Meets Henry works for readers up to grade 4.0.
We rate Adventures of Belle - Belle Meets Henry as 7C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.
Thematically, Adventures of Belle - Belle Meets Henry explores friendship, community, and interpersonal relations —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
